Eomaia skeleton, topology and locomotor inference

An articulated Early Cretaceous skeleton preserves dentition, feet and claws used in competing therian matrices and locomotor interpretations.

CAGS 01-IG-1a,b preserves an articulated skeleton with dentition, feet and claws; the original matrix placed Eomaia near the eutherian root and inferred scansoriality, while later combined matrices can place it outside Theria, so neither topology nor locomotor habit is a directly observed ancestral state.
